Robert C. LaRose Joins Greatwide as Chief Financial Officer

July 14, 2009

 


DALLAS (July 14, 2009) - Greatwide Logistics Services, a national provider of non-asset-based transportation and third-party logistics services, today announced that Bob LaRose has joined the company as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er.

"The addition of Bob LaRose to the team is an important part of the next phase of the company's growth," said Ray Greer, CEO of Greatwide. "Bob will play an instrumental role in realizing the potential that exists in leveraging Greatwide's multiple product lines to create integrated logistics solutions for our clients and core markets."

LaRose will have full financial and accounting responsibility across all four of Greatwide's lines of business: Dedicated Transport, Truckload Management, Distribution Logistics and Freight Brokerage. He will also play a day-to-day role in Truckload Management given his experience with non-asset and agent-based truckload services.

"Greatwide is a company on the move", said LaRose. "Greatwide has a strong balance sheet, exceptional financial backing and a unique set of logistics competencies. As a result, I believe we have all of the necessary ingredients for accelerated growth by bringing new and innovative solutions to the market. I am excited to join the executive team that has built a strong platform for success."

Prior to joining Greatwide, LaRose served as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er of Landstar System, Inc. He has also held a variety of financial leadership roles in both public and private companies that include American Brands, Chiquita Brands and General Host Corporation. LaRose started his career with Arthur Young and is a Certified Public Accountant.


About Greatwide Logistics Services:
Founded in Dallas, Texas in 2000, Greatwide Logistics Services is a privately held, $1 billion third-party logistics services company. The company is ranked No. 22 on the Commercial Carrier Journal 250 and No. 24 on the Traffic World Top 100 lists. The company has four primary lines of business: dedicated transport, truckload management, freight brokerage and distribution logistics. Greatwide is one of the nation's leading non-asset-based logistics providers of transportation, third-party logistics, warehouse/distribution and freight brokerage solutions.
